Since corona virus was first sited in Kenya in the month of March to date, the country has recorded increased gender-based violence, mental health issues, and violation of children’s rights. Overall, there has been aggravated cases of child abuse including: defilement, missing children due to abductions, child murders,
physical abuse, teenage pregnancies, among others.

After the closure of all learning institutions in the month of March 2020, Kenya’s teenage pregnancy is on an all-time high with over 150,000 girls aged 10 to 19 years being recorded as being pregnant. All these pregnancies happened in a span of 4 months, between the months of March to June 2020. Many more cases go unreported.
